Job Title: Teacher of English (1 year Maternity initially)Salary Range: Teachers Main Pay Scale/UPS Responsible to: Relevant Subject Leader Responsible for: Teaching English in the Upper and Lower School. Purpose:Teaching staff are expected to make a significant and sustained contribution to the core purpose of the academy – ensuring all students achieve their full potential; taking a leading role in promoting high academic standards and a positive ethos.Core Duties:You are required to carry out the duties of a school teacher as set out in the relevant paragraphs of the current Teachers Conditions of Employment document. This includes: Teaching English in the Upper/Lower School and across the full ability range; following departmental schemes of work, the National Curriculum and the relevant subject specifications. Contributing to the development of departmental schemes of learning. Setting and marking homework, in line with academy/departmental policy. Integrating the development of key skills (Numeracy, Literacy and ICT etc.), SMSC and Cultural Capital into their teaching. Monitoring and assessing students, in line with academy/departmental policy. Actively promoting the academy’s high expectations and equal opportunities policy. Contributing to the academy meeting cycle. Maintaining a safe and attractive teaching and learning environment.Other Duties:To assist the Principal in ensuring that the academy runs smoothly, and acting in a management capacity, as the need arises. This includes: Helping to maintain outstanding behaviour around the academy at all times by undertaking daily duties and providing pastoral support for students, as appropriate. Undertaking the responsibilities of a Form Tutor and attending assemblies on a regular basis. Maintaining sound procedures for security, supervision, and maintenance of the academy environment, ensuring that all safeguarding/health and safety regulations are met. Modeling the highest standards of professional conduct, supporting and driving excellence in all practice within the academy; ensuring that Cliff Park Ormiston Academy and the Ormiston Academies Trust is always presented positively within and beyond the academy.
